Pectinase acts on the pectic substances found in fruit cell walls and pulp. When these pectin structures remain intact, they can create haze, slow settling, high pulp drag, and difficult filterability.

Different fruits do not behave the same way in tank. Apple juice may carry press-related pectin and fine pulp. Berry juices can retain color-rich suspended solids and seed-derived material. Tropical blends may combine puree viscosity with soluble pectin. Citrus blends can bring peel-derived pectin and emulsion complexity.

Pectinase can be positioned at several points depending on fruit type, process temperature, residence time, and target clarity.
Applied before pressing or separation, pectinase can help loosen the fruit matrix, reduce pulp resistance, and improve liquid release. This is often useful when high pulp viscosity limits pressing, decanting, or puree handling.
After juice extraction, pectinase can be used in a controlled holding step to reduce soluble pectin and prepare the juice for settling, fining, centrifugation, or filtration.
When filters blind quickly or differential pressure rises too fast, pectinase can be used upstream to reduce pectin-driven load before final clarification or polishing.

Pectinase is not a universal fix for every haze problem. Protein haze, starch haze, microbial instability, oil emulsions, and mineral interactions may require different process controls. In many beverage systems, pectinase is one part of a broader clarification strategy.
